Scientific Drilling is looking for a Field Engineer, Aberdeen, UK, to work offshore as well as in international locations. Scientific Drilling is an independent MWD Wellbore Navigation, Gyro Surveying and Cased Hole Logging Service Company serving customers worldwide. Our industry leading navigation systems provide definitive wellbore placement information, enabling safer and more efficient placement of tightly spaced wellbores throughout the world. We are motivated by creating innovative and elegant solutions to technically challenging problems.

The Field Engineer is expected to perform the essential duties listed below:


Duties and Responsibilities

  • High level of client interaction requires technical skills, the ability to interact daily with colleagues and customers at all levels, and the ability to lead a team or work diligently in a standalone capacity
  • Safety, service quality, job preparation, planning and execution are considered key priorities.
  • Must safely operate SDI's suite of downhole technologies at the well site
  • Exercising judgment to determine the appropriate action at the well site when performing well site surveys and monitoring well sensors.
  • Recognizing the operational status of field equipment at the well site and maintaining it when appropriate.
  • Provide advice and direction to external customer and third-party wellsite colleagues as appropriate.
  • Provide resolution to a diverse scope and range of complex problems at the wellsite where analysis of data requires having a broad knowledge of the product line tool(s) and service(s)
  • Preparation, calibration and functioning testing of equipment in the workshop and on onshore and offshore site locations
  • Ensure data is recorded, prepared, checked, certified and filed to conform with company policies and customer requirements
  • Ensure company QA policy and recommended operating procedures are followed and adhered to in operation of all company equipment
  • Carry out all work in a safe manner and in accordance with company and client policy and national legislation
  • This position involves being on-call for assignment anyway within the district, with assignment to any District or area on a temporary basis
  • Perform other relevant duties as requested/required by management

Education, Experience, Certification and Training

  • Educated to university level in Science/Engineering discipline or equivalent, or relevant oilfield experience
  • Offshore experience, with running downhole tools and/or monitoring of rig site sensors is advantageous
  • Ongoing job-specific training will be provided as required
  • Valid UK driving license is required
  • Candidate must have the right to live and work in the U.K.
